Bitcoin ATM Fees & Limits in Lawrence Township, NJ
10–23%
No statutory fee cap in New Jersey
We have not verified a current statutory fee cap for New Jersey. Check the state regulations guide for current requirements. Industry-wide, fees run 10–23% of the transaction once the exchange-rate spread is counted. Treat this as an industry range, not a measurement of Lawrence Township.
General Licensing
New Jersey requires money transmitter licensing under its general transmission framework; no Bitcoin ATM-specific statute identified.

How do I use a Bitcoin ATM in Lawrence Township?
To buy Bitcoin at an ATM in Lawrence Township: (1) Find a location using the map above, (2) bring cash and a valid ID, (3) scan your Bitcoin wallet QR code or create a new wallet at the machine, (4) insert cash, and (5) confirm the transaction. Most ATMs have a $20 minimum purchase.
